There is a difference of 5 inches in height between CJ and Eric, but you do not know who
is taller. Let c represent CJ's height, and let e represent Eric's height. Formulate an
absolute value equation to relate the heights.

Answers

Answer 1

Step-by-step explanation:

The difference between the height of CJ and Eric is 5 inches. It means the height of CJ is either 5 inches higher or 5 inches lower (-5 inches higher) than Eric.

Therefore, we can set up the equation,

[tex]|c-e|=5[/tex]

Alternatively, if we use CJ as the reference,

[tex]|e-c|=5[/tex]

what would be 0.93 repeating as a fraction in simplest form​

Answers

Answer:

First, set x equal to .93

x=.939393939393...

Then, since the repeating is by two digits, let's multiply x by 100

This would make 100x=93.9393939393...

Now, we can subtract 100x−x

This would leave us with 99x=93 because the repeating digits cancel out.

The denominator of a rational number is greater than its numerator by 7. If the numerator is increased by 6 and the denominator is decreased by 5, the new rational number obtained is 3/2. Find the original rational number.

Answers

Answer:

6/13

Step-by-step explanation:

6    +   6    =    12            3

----                    ----    =    ---

13     -   5    =     8            2

Answer:

Original Rational number is = 6/13

Step-by-step explanation:

Let Numerator be : x

Denominator be : x + 7

Now,

Numerator is increased by 6Denominator is decreased by 5the new rational number obtained is 3/2

Numerator = x + 6

Denominator = ( x + 7) - 5

According to the question,

[tex] \displaystyle \: \sf \dashrightarrow \: \frac{x + 6}{(x + 7) \: - 5} = \: \frac{3}{2} [/tex]

[tex]\displaystyle \: \sf \dashrightarrow \: 2(x + 6) \: = 3 \{ \: (x + 7 ) - 5\} \: [/tex]

[tex]\displaystyle \: \sf \dashrightarrow \: 2x \: + 12 \: = \: 3(x + 2)[/tex]

[tex]\displaystyle \: \sf \dashrightarrow2x + 12 \: = 3x + 6[/tex]

[tex]\displaystyle \: \sf \dashrightarrow \: 2x - 3x \: = \: 6 - 12[/tex]

[tex] \: \: \: \displaystyle \: \sf \dashrightarrow \: - x \: = - 6 \\ \\ \: \: \: \: \: \: \displaystyle \: \bf \dashrightarrow \: x \: = 6[/tex]

Numerator = 6

Denominator = x + 7

= 6 + 7

= 13
